Nordic Tankers and WOMAR Holdings LLC Have Signed a Letter of Intent to Establish a Joint Marketing Agreement Print E-mail

Monday, 26 April 2010 05:45

Commencing 1 June 2010 it is the intention that, Nordic Tankers and WOMAR will start marketing each others' coated chemical tankers in the range of 10,000 to 17,000 deadweight tonnes (dwt) in their individual areas of primary marketing strength. The Letter of Intent is subject to execution of a final agreement.

Nordic Tankers strength in the West combined with WOMAR's strength in the East will enable the parties to produce an integrated global service for their customers and increase efficiency and utilization of ships under management.

WOMAR currently operates three pools with a total of around 40 vessels of which about 20 are in the 10,000 to 17,000 dwt segment. Nordic Tankers manages about 70 vessels of which about 20 are in the 10,000 to 17,000 dwt segment. The agreement enhances WOMAR capabilities in the West and similarly, the agreement also enhances Nordic Tankers' commercial capabilities in the Eastern hemisphere.

It is the aim that the parties establish a jointly owned independent pool management company. The name, location and jurisdiction of this new company will be mutually agreed.

"This Letter of Intent is in line with our strategy of prudent and profitable growth with a target of more than 150 vessels under management in 2013. WOMAR's strong position in Asia is a perfect match for Nordic Tankers as it supplements our strong position west of the Suez Canal," said Nordic Tankers CEO Tommy Thomsen.

"Nordic Tankers' well known presence in Western markets and this potential strategic alliance will further enhance our services to our customers providing efficient access to the global markets. The complementary activities of Nordic Tankers provide a natural next logical step of our motto - "Leadership Through Service" said WOMAR CEO - Hans Van Der Zijde.

According to plans, the potential new pool management company shall manage one or more commercial pools of coated chemical tankers in the 10,000 to 17,000 dwt segment with an expected initial pool of about 35 tankers.

This Letter of Intent and potential final agreement does not change Nordic Tankers' financial outlook for 2010.
